After the singer was refused entry to a Canadian hotel in 1951 because he was wearing jeans, Leviโ€™s created a denim tuxedo for Crosby with a leather patch verifying it as formal attire. The Canadian Tuxedo was born.

For a brand founded to outfit the working man โ€“ eventually acknowledging the working woman in 1932 with Lady Leviโ€™s โ€“ democratic staples remain firmly in the mix.

Classics such as the 501 jeans (made famous by Bruce Springsteen, Marilyn Monroe and James Dean) and fitted trucker jackets have been enhanced by premium denims and stitching techniques developed in Japanese factories.

While jeans in Leviโ€™s regular Red Tab range start at $129.95, the Blue Tab range takes a step up, starting at $329.95.

โ€œIn our world, itโ€™s luxury,โ€ Oโ€™Neill says. โ€œI donโ€™t think of it as a luxury brand. Itโ€™s a premium denim brand. If you look at a luxury denim brand, itโ€™s a huge leap forward with the price. We are not quite up at $1000 jeans.

โ€œI do think that we are providing something that is a superior product to most of the luxury denim brands that cost $1000.โ€

Even $1000 is conservative pricing in that department. The bootleg jeans from French luxury label Celine, worn by rapper Kendrick Lamar at the Super Bowl half-time show, cost $1700 and promptly sold out. Cropped denim jackets from Prada cost $3500, while baggy Balenciaga jeans cost $2350.

The jeans for 2025

Straight leg
This classic style, which suits most body types, was recently worn by Meghan Markle at the Invictus Games. Bottega Veneta revived it in 2023, but Leviโ€™s has been making this classic โ€œfor 150 yearsโ€, Oโ€™Neill says.

Barrel leg
These horseshoe-shaped jeans have gained popularity with women, offering more structure than a wide-leg jean, while balancing broad shoulders and skimming pear-shaped figures. Leave the sneakers at home. Best worn with slippers or kitten heels.

What about skinny jeans?
Theyโ€™re having a moment for the fashion-forward. Remember, skinny jeans wonโ€™t make your legs skinny. Look for styles with higher waists to avoid unwelcome underwear sightings.
